This report outlines a strategic framework for high-net-worth investors, emphasizing the importance of integrating tax-aware investment management, coordinated estate planning, risk mitigation, and liquidity alignment to optimize financial outcomes. The document identifies a core issue where affluent investors often receive fragmented advice across investment, tax, and estate strategies, leading to inefficiencies. By adopting a cohesive approach, such as coordinating capital gains realization with tax brackets and utilizing trusts and gifting strategies, investors can significantly enhance long-term compounding. An example provided shows a $3M portfolio reducing annual tax drag by over 1% through strategic harvesting and asset location. Common pitfalls include overconcentration in single assets and delayed estate planning. The report concludes with a case for integrated, fiduciary-driven wealth management to ensure clarity and efficiency in achieving financial goals.
